A Very Busy Friday
Friday, March 2, 2007
The past two days I have been chasing my tail fixing bugs for AIM 6.1 and getting a refresh out the door for AIM MusicLink. Before I get to those fun details, I wanted to share a few interesting tidbits I found this week.
*** While doing some research for my blog post on the future of news media, I stumbled across the travel reporters blog on the Washington Post. There was a blog post by John Deiner detailing the Top 20 travel web sites used in January. How many people would have guessed Mapquest would lead the way as the most popular web site? They beat out the likes of Expedia, Yahoo, Google and all of the airlines. Great job Mapquest.
*** For those of you asking about the Location Plugin not installing on Vista, we are working on getting a new build posted very soon.
*** I was sent a link by a co-worker this afternoon showing me the new beta webmail experience we have. You can test it out by going to http://beta.webmail.aol.com. Immediately obvious is the interface is much nicer, and definitely performs faster than the old webmail page. Here is a link to the product insider blog for webmail.
Now onto AIM MusicLink. Thank you everyone for the feedback, as you know earlier this week I fixed the Vista install problem, today I flushed out some other issues reported.
- Added a preference to not add hyperlink to your profile. I will still add the song, but it will not hyperlink if this pref is set.
- Sharing music in your status message and profile are on by default now, so you no longer need to open the user interface to set the preferences for MusicLink to start doing its thing.
- Removed two annoying install dialog boxes popping up during install.
- Uninstall now unregisters the MusicLink dll
- Only one MusicLink window will open no matter how many times you open the MusicLink window
- MusicLink can now be loaded from the settings button in the plugin prefs.
You can download AIM MusicLink 1.0.0.4 here. As always feedback is appreciated.
